The europeans are definatly scouting our market. The euro economy is just as much a shell game as our own, only with less wealth being created. Or I should say less wealth spread around.

The europeans (particularly the French) have also taken a huge hit in the Middle East market. Watch the background in the news coverage of Iran, Syria, Iraq, Lebanon etc. you will see lots of French cars.

With all the uncertanty car sales have dropped like a rock in the middle east. This has little effect on US makes because we were never a big part of that market.

Lastly once we have the clean diesel standard in effect the euro marques can flood us with relativly cheap common rail diesels that get near hybrid MPG without needing a new battery right after the warrantee expires.
